REL 200 - Survey of the Old Testament
Surveys books of the Old Testament, with emphasis on prophetic historical books. Examines the historical and geographical setting and place of the Israelites in the ancient Middle East as background to the writings.
Lecture 3 hours per week.
3 credits
REL 210 - Survey of the New Testament
Surveys books of the New Testament, with special attention upon placing the writings within their historical and geographical setting.
Lecture 3 hours per week.
3 credits
REL 215 - New Testament and Early Christianity
Surveys the history, literature, and theology of early Christianity in the light of the New Testament.
Lecture 3 hours per week.
3 credits
REL 216 - Life and Teachings of Jesus
Studies the major themes in the teachings of Jesus of Nazareth as recorded in the Gospels, and examines the events of his life in light of modern biblical and historical scholarship.
Lecture 3 hours per week.
3 credits
REL 230 - Religions of the World
Introduces the major religions of the world: Judaism, Christianity, Islam, Hinduism, and Buddhism. Focuses on origins, history, basic beliefs, values, ethics, and practices. This is a Passport and UCGS transfer course.
Lecture 3 hours. Total 3 hours per week.
3 credits
